Anticestodial Efficacy and GC-MS Study of Evolvulus nummularius, a Traditionally Used Anthelmintic Plant of North–East India

The whole plant of Evolvulus nummularius is traditionally used to treat helminth infections in Assam, India. This study was taken to evaluate the efficacy of its methanolic extract in suitable models in vitro and in vivo.
MethodsHymenolepis diminuta exposed in vitro to E. nummularius were also studied for damages to its tegument using scanning electron microscopy. Also, the plant extract’s ability to inhibit AChE activity was assessed. The extract was later processed for GC-MS analysis to detect the phytocompounds present.
ResultsIn vitro study showed significant efficacy against H. diminuta and in vivo study revealed 76.93% and 71% reduction in eggs and worm counts respectively against juvenile H. diminuta worms, whereas, the extract caused 80% and 79.25% reduction in these parameters against H. diminuta adult worms. The extract also showed to cause 55.73% reduction in AChE activity. H. diminuta worms exposed to plant extract showed deformities in the suckers, tegument, microtriches and suckers. Its GC-MS study revealed the presence of (-)-deoxyephedrine, methamphetamine, 1-(5-methoxy-2-methylphenyl)-N-methylpropan-2-amine, ethyl vanillin, 3,4-dihydroxypropiophenone, and 1-(1,4-cyclohexadienyl)-2-methylaminopropane.
ConclusionThe results infer that E. nummularius possess significant anthelmintic activity and may be used in traditional medicine.
